Examples of Hidden Careers Students Should Know

1. Ethical Hacker

While hacking is usually seen as negative, an ethical hacker uses their skills to protect organizations from cyber threats. Companies are now hiring specialists to secure their systems. With the rise of digital payments and online learning, this field is booming. You can learn more through global resources like Coursera which offer beginner-friendly cybersecurity courses.

2. Food Stylist

Have you ever wondered how food looks so perfect in advertisements or cooking shows? That is the work of a food stylist. It is a blend of art, creativity, and presentation. Students with an interest in photography, cooking, and design can explore this career path.

3. Renewable Energy Technician

The world is moving toward sustainability. Careers in solar energy, wind energy, and electric vehicles are in high demand. A renewable energy technician helps in designing, maintaining, and implementing eco-friendly energy solutions. For global insights, check International Energy Agency.

4. Wildlife Conservationist

For students passionate about nature and animals, becoming a wildlife conservationist is a fulfilling career. It involves protecting endangered species, managing forest areas, and educating communities about biodiversity.

5. UX Designer

User Experience (UX) designers create apps, websites, and tools that are easy and enjoyable to use. With the growth of the digital economy, UX designers are in demand across industries. Websites like UX Design provide insights for beginners.

6. Drone Operator

Drones are not just toys; they are tools used in filmmaking, agriculture, construction, and defense. Skilled drone operators can build a rewarding career by offering their expertise in aerial photography or crop monitoring.

7. Esports Athlete

Gaming has transformed into a professional career. Esports athletes participate in global tournaments, win sponsorships, and earn recognition just like traditional sports players. This field is perfect for students who are passionate about competitive gaming and teamwork.

8. Data Analyst for Sports

Sports teams now hire data analysts to study player performance and strategy. Students who love sports but are also good at mathematics and statistics can shine in this career.

Steps for Students to Discover Hidden Careers

If you are a student, here are practical steps to start discovering hidden opportunities:

  1. Identify strengths and interests: Write down subjects and hobbies you truly enjoy.
  2. Explore beyond textbooks: Watch documentaries, read blogs, and take short online courses.
  3. Experiment with projects: Try small projects such as building a website, designing a poster, or volunteering for a nature club.
  4. Seek mentorship: Talk to teachers, counselors, or professionals in the field you admire.
  5. Stay updated: Read about future careers in technology, environment, and global industries.
